우분투 파이어폭스에서, 로지텍 M510 마우스 사이드 버튼 설정

사용자 삽입 이미지제가 쓰는 마우스가 로지텍의 MX510인데요, 이 마우스는 브라우저에서 페이지 앞뒤로 전환할수 있는 편리한 버튼과 페이지 업다운, 프로그램 전환등의 다양한 보조 버튼들이 있습니다. 그런데 우분투에서는 이게 자동으로 인식되지 않습니다. 설정 방법을 인터넷에서 찾아봤지만, 워낙 여러가지 방법이 많고, 그중에는 부팅시 에러를 유발하는 잘못된 방법도 많습니다. 그래서 제대로된 방법을 찾는데 오래걸렸네요.

xorg.conf를 수정합니다. 백업은 습관.

sudo gedit /etc/X11/xorg.conf

마우스 부분 코드를 찾아 수정합니다. (붉은 색 부분)

Section “InputDevice”
        Identifier      “Configured Mouse”
        Driver          “mouse”
        Option          “CorePointer”
        Option          “Device”                “/dev/input/mice”
        Option          “Protocol”              “auto”
        Option          “Buttons”               “7”
        Option          “ZAxisMapping”          “4 5”
        Option          “ButtonMapping”         “1 2 3 6 7 4 5 6”
EndSection

수정후 저장하고 X를 재시작합니다.

출처는
http://ubuntuforums.org/showthread.php?t=485175

이 방법은 MX510외에도
*LogiTech G5
*LogiTech wireless Media Play
*MX600 cordless laser
*MX610 laser
등에 사용할수 있다고 원문에 써있는데, MX500도 MX510과 같은 구성이니 쓸수 있을겁니다.

ps.
파이어폭스3는 버튼 매핑이 바뀌었다.

Section “InputDevice”
        Identifier      “Configured Mouse”
        Driver          “mouse”
        Option          “CorePointer”
        Option          “Device”                “/dev/input/mice”
        Option          “Protocol”              “auto”
        Option          “Buttons”               “7”
        Option          “ZAxisMapping”          “4 5”
       Option          “ButtonMapping”     “1 2 3 8 9”
EndSection

글쓴이 : Draco (https://draco.pe.kr)
크리에이티브 커먼즈 라이선스
이 저작물은 크리에이티브 커먼즈 저작자표시 4.0 국제 라이선스에 따라 이용할 수 있습니다.

댓글 4개

  1. 안녕하세요.

    드디어 집에 와서 마우스 설정해보려고 파일을 열었는데 전

    Section “InputDevice”
    # generated from default
    Identifier “Mouse0”
    Driver “mouse”
    Option “Protocol” “auto”
    Option “Device” “/dev/psaux”
    Option “Emulate3Buttons” “no”
    Option “ZAxisMapping” “4 5”
    EndSection

    라고 설정이 되어 있네요. 지금 해보니 왼쪽 보조 버튼이 모두 인식되고 있습니다. 그럼 그냥 문제 없는 건가요? (대뜸 나타나서 이상한 질문해서 죄송합니다. ㅠㅠ)

댓글 달기

이메일 주소는 공개되지 않습니다. 필수 필드는 *로 표시됩니다

이 사이트는 스팸을 줄이는 아키스밋을 사용합니다. 댓글이 어떻게 처리되는지 알아보십시오.